Common fungicide harms earthworms' gut health and reproduction

The earthworms tilling and aerating your garden soil right now could be quietly poisoned by a fungicide commonly used to fight nematodes in soil.

Scientists found that fluopyram, a fungicide farmers and gardeners use to control soil nematodes, accumulates inside earthworms and throws their bodies out of balance. It triggers cell-damaging stress inside the worms and messes up the community of bacteria in their gut, which then leaves them struggling to grow and reproduce normally. Since earthworms are one of the best indicators of healthy soil, this is a red flag for anyone relying on soil-applied fungicides.

Key Findings

1

Fluopyram accumulated in earthworm guts at 2.73 mg/kg, suppressing both growth and reproduction

2

The fungicide triggered oxidative stress via the JNK signaling pathway, confirmed through transcriptome analysis

3

Digestive enzyme activity dropped and gut microbial network complexity/stability were disrupted
